歡迎來到Linux教程網
Linux教程網
Linux教程網
Linux教程網
您现在的位置: Linux教程網 >> UnixLinux >  >> Linux編程 >> Linux編程

使用Visual Studio Code從零開始開發調試.NET Core 1.0

使用VS Code 從零開始開發調試.NET Core 1.0。.NET Core 是一個開源的、跨平台的 .NET 實現。Visual Studio Code是一個輕量級的跨平台Web集成開發環境,可以運行在 Linux,Mac 和Windows下!

從零開始開發調試.NET Core 1.0,讓你更好的了解.NET Core 應用程序。

本篇Visual Studio Code 開發教程是在Windows做實際操作,但同樣適用於其它系統。VS Code 的目的就是為了跨平台開發。

環境安裝

本文演示開發環境: Win10 x64 Visual Studio Code 1.2.1

.NET Core SDK Installer:

https://download.microsoft.com/download/A/3/8/A38489F3-9777-41DD-83F8-2CBDFAB2520C/packages/DotNetCore.1.0.0-SDK.Preview2-x64.exe

SDK 如果安裝過 RC2及之前版本,請先卸載然後再安裝。

更多系統版本下載:

https://www.microsoft.com/net/download

VSCode :

https://code.visualstudio.com/

VSCode C#插件:

Ctrl+P 打開Quick Open 輸入: ext install csharp  選擇C# 安裝。

安裝好插件以後重啟VS Code。

重磅推薦:

自帶 OmniSharp server 離線 C#插件包,基於 最新 csharp-1.2.1 插件代碼封裝。

下載地址:

 

------------------------------------------分割線------------------------------------------

 

FTP地址:ftp://ftp1.linuxidc.com

 

用戶名:ftp1.linuxidc.com

 

密碼:www.linuxidc.com

 

在 2016年LinuxIDC.com\7月\使用Visual Studio Code從零開始開發調試.NET Core 1.0\

 

下載方法見 http://www.linuxidc.com/Linux/2013-10/91140.htm

 

------------------------------------------分割線------------------------------------------ 

 

注意事項:本插件只適用於 windows x64 系統 ,其他系統請使用ext install csharp 下載官方插件。

安裝方法:使用 VS Code 打開文件選擇 csharp-1.2.1-LineZero.vsix 打開即可

 

創建項目

首先確保 DotNetCore.1.0.0-SDK 安裝成功。

dotnet --version

輸出如下:

1.0.0-preview2-003121

然後就可以創建項目。

dotnet new

dotnet restore

dotnet run

整個命令執行完成。

 

使用 VS Code 開發

使用 VS Code 打開netcore文件夾。

注意:

這裡如果使用 ext install csharp 安裝C#插件的,首次打開需要耐心等待一下。

因為需要配置 .NET Core Debugger  及下載  OmniSharp server。

之前評論區 出現  OmniSharp server is not running 就是因為 OmniSharp server 沒有下載下來。

直到出現下圖所示才算安裝成功,二者不能缺一, 然後才能後續操作。

 

使用離線安裝包,只需要看到 Successfully installed .NET Core Debugger. 即可。

 

只有成功安裝,才會有智能提示,以及添加配置文件提示。

上圖提示選擇Yes  即可。插件會自動為我們配置好 launch.json

 

然後我們切換到調試窗口就可以進行調試

下斷點成功斷下。

我們也可以很方便的編寫代碼,插件為我們提供智能提示功能。

 

這樣我們就可以跨平台開發.NET Core 1.0程序

Ubuntu 14.04 安裝Visual Studio Code  http://www.linuxidc.com/Linux/2016-03/129052.htm

使用Visual Studio Code開發TypeScript  http://www.linuxidc.com/Linux/2015-07/119456.htm

Visual Studio Code 簡單試用體驗  http://www.linuxidc.com/Linux/2015-05/116887.htm

Visual Studio Code試用體驗  http://www.linuxidc.com/Linux/2015-07/120378.htm

Visual Studio 2010 & Help Library Manager 安裝說明 http://www.linuxidc.com/Linux/2012-11/74814.htm

OpenCV 2.3.x/2.4.x在Visual Studio 2005/2008和Visual Studio 2010配置方法詳解 http://www.linuxidc.com/Linux/2012-08/68302.htm

使用OpenCV-2.4.0.exe文件編譯x86或x64平台Visual Studio 2005/2008/2010目標文件 http://www.linuxidc.com/Linux/2012-08/68305.htm

Visual Studio LightSwitch增加對HTML5和JavaScript的支持 http://www.linuxidc.com/Linux/2012-06/63397.htm

Visual Studio 11:使用 C++ 開發一個最簡單的 Metro 應用 http://www.linuxidc.com/Linux/2012-06/62657.htm

Ubuntu 14.04如何安裝Visual studio Code  http://www.linuxidc.com/Linux/2016-07/132886.htm

Visual Studio 的詳細介紹:請點這裡
Visual Studio 的下載地址:請點這裡

Copyright © Linux教程網 All Rights Reserved